Contents
Ch. 1. Understanding sudden infant death syndrome. An overview of sudden infant death syndrome / Teresa Odle and Jacqueline L. Longe -- How to reduce the risk of SIDS / Mary Best -- SIDS is a complicated disease / Margaret Renkl -- Low serotonin levels may cause SIDS / Children's Hospital Boston -- The search for a genetic cause of SIDS / Vita Lerman -- Ch. 2. Controversies surrounding SIDS. Toxic gases in crib mattresses are to blame for SIDS / Jane Sheppard -- Toxic gases in crib mattresses do not cause SIDS / First Candle -- The Back to Sleep campaign has been successful / National Institute of Child Health and Human Development -- Parents are ignoring the Back to Sleep campaign / Heather Sokoloff -- Vaccines may cause SIDS / Ingri Cassel -- Vaccines are not a risk factor for SIDS / US Centers for Disease Control and Prevention -- Ch. 3. Personal experiences with SIDS. We were young then and did not know about SIDS / Jonathan and Bridgette Alexander -- A SIDS story of joy, heartbreak, and healing / Stephanie Williams -- A father's story about losing his son to SIDS / Marvin Job.
